A series of novel (S)-amino acid derivatives bearing planar-chiral (3-acylamino-1,2-dicarba-closo-dodecaboran-1-yl)acetyl substituents was synthesized. Carboranyl amino esters were obtained in a diastereomerically pure form (according to chiral HPLC). Single crystals of individual diastereomers were studied by optical microscopy, X-ray diffraction analysis and piezoresponse force microscopy. The piezoelectric activity of some compounds was shown to exceed that of most known organic piezoelectrics.
